NORTH BRANCH is an 11 MW oil power plant in Chisago County, MN, operated by NORTH BRANCH WATER & LIGHT COMM, commissioned in 2003. Chisago County carries high modeled catastrophe exposure in the FEMA National Risk Index, scoring 4.0 of 5 at the 74th national percentile. Strong wind is the leading peril, rated Relatively Moderate by FEMA at the 89th percentile.

The Bywatts loss layer is calibrated to solar PV hardware, so it is not applied to an oil plant. The ratings below are the FEMA National Risk Index county hazard ratings for this location.

Perils not assessed in Chisago County

These perils carry no usable National Risk Index figure for this county, so they are excluded from the scoring rather than scored zero. A zero would claim the peril was assessed and found benign.

PerilWhy it is not scored
HurricaneFEMA rating is "Not Applicable" for this county
Coastal floodingFEMA rating is "Not Applicable" for this county
